Question 483438: Given sinB =11/18 find angle B in degrees. Round your answer to the nearest hundredth.
Answer by stanbon(75887)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Given sinB =11/18 find angle B in degrees.
Round your answer to the nearest hundredth.
--------------
sin^-1(11/18) = 37.67 degrees
